Built in 1961, the David Brown 2B-850D is a tractor from David Brown. 27 kW is what the four-cylinder engine gets out of 2.5 litres.
Dimensions are 2.90 m by 1.60 m. Unladen weight is 1,650 kg.
Within the range, rated power spans from 10.6 to 66.9 kW; with 27 kW, the 2B-850D sits in the lower third. Directly alongside are the CROPMASTER with 26 kW below and the 2B-850D/1910-62 with 28 kW above.

What to check before buying
- Check the hour meter against the service records — a replaced instrument is the most common gap.
- Compare the data plate and chassis number with the papers.
- Check the weights in the papers against the figures here — attachments change them.
- Load the hydraulics and watch for sag.
- Ask about parts availability for this build year — the running costs hang on it.
A general list for this type of machine — no substitute for an inspection or an appraiser.
